Output d3c18b8340dd5a002eefaf95aac3bf154a61f5de52c89cae2d28210fd4956be5:6

value
105396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21cbe29269cdfbb45943ef14dbb2b2b57fdf177d OP_EQUAL
address
34miU4B74knSXfyWcqa4M34XHcEvdzHzJ3
transaction
d3c18b8340dd5a002eefaf95aac3bf154a61f5de52c89cae2d28210fd4956be5
spent
true